Easy WebDev | Frontend & Backend
9.37K subscribers
413 photos
1 video
413 links
🌐 Канал для Web-разработчиков — лучшие гайды, курсы, инструменты, ресурсы и другие полезности.

Связь: @jorogue

Биржа: https://telega.in/c/easy_webdev_tg
Download Telegram
🚤 Покоряем Kubernetes: от базовых концепций к эффективному управлению контейнерами

Даже если вам ещё не приходилось напрямую сталкиваться с Kubernetes, скорее всего, вы уже знаете, что это особая платформа для управления виртуальными контейнерами.

👉 В ней находятся приложения со всеми необходимыми зависимостями.

Автор этой статьи разобрал основные тонкости работы с Kubernetes: от запуска приложения до полноценного использования в проектах.


Ссылка: Клик!

Easy WebDev | #Статьи
Please open Telegram to view this post
VIEW IN TELEGRAM
🔥43👍3
☕️ Java-инструмент для подмножеств БД и просмотра реляционных данных

Этот инструмент создаёт небольшие срезы из вашей базы данных и позволяет вам перемещаться по ней, следуя связям.

Идеально подходит для:
🔵создания небольших выборок тестовых данных;
🔵локального анализа проблем с соответствующими производственными данными.


Ссылка: Клик!

Easy WebDev | #Инструменты
Please open Telegram to view this post
VIEW IN TELEGRAM
👍5🔥4
🔎 Как определить текущее местоположение пользователя на сайте?

Автор статьи по шагам расскажет, как реализовать такой функционал и продемонстрирует всё на реальном примере.

🔵Задача была выполнена на Options API, фреймворке Vue, но сам код написан на чистом JS.

🔵Это может быть полезно и тем, кто пишет на React или других фреймворках.


Ссылка: Клик!

Easy WebDev | #Статьи
Please open Telegram to view this post
VIEW IN TELEGRAM
👍53🔥3💯2
🌐 Что такое Webhook и чем отличается от API?

Миллиарды веб-приложений обмениваются данными в режиме реального времени, используя вебхуки.

👉 Это такие специальные запросы для уведомлений, которые отличаются от обычного API.

В видеоуроке подробно рассмотрим данную технологию и разберёмся, как вебхуки работают «под капотом».


Ссылка: Клик!

Easy WebDev | #Видео
Please open Telegram to view this post
VIEW IN TELEGRAM
👍8🔥3🙏2
👩‍💻 Юнит-тестирование в Angular: лучшие практики и инструменты

Автор этой статьи поделился опытом, который накопил за годы работы с юнит-тестами в Angular.

Вот, о чём пойдёт речь:
🔵Почему важно писать юнит-тесты;
🔵Зачем мокать зависимости и каковы плюсы и минусы;
🔵Что такое SIFERS и почему это важно;
🔵Что такое Angular Testing Library;
🔵Как тестировать с помощью SIFERS;
🔵Как получать элементы DOM и генерировать события;
🔵Что такое jest-auto-spies и observer-spy.


Ссылка: Клик!

Easy WebDev | #Статьи
Please open Telegram to view this post
VIEW IN TELEGRAM
👍3🙏32🔥1
🖱 Интерактивная обучалка кодингу на JavaScript

Всё просто — есть три уровня: для детей, подростков и взрослых. Возрастное разделение условное, скорее речь об уровне знаний.

По задумке автора, в этой игре нужно редактировать код и писать его самому. Например, поменять цвета двух квадратов, переместить и объединить их.


Ссылка: Клик!

Easy WebDev | #Игры
Please open Telegram to view this post
VIEW IN TELEGRAM
👍6🔥3🤩211
🤓 Git для самых маленьких: от первой команды до настройки SSH

Автор этой статьи объединил полную первоначальную настройку SSH и базовые команды, которые помогут быстро начать работать с Git.

🔵Начальные команды Git — были описаны ключевые команды для управления репозиториями, включая создание, редактирование и управление ветками.

🔵Настройка SSH для Git — дано пошаговое руководство по настройке подключения по SSH для безопасной и удобной работы с удаленными репозиториями, а также подписью коммитов.


Ссылка: Клик!

Easy WebDev | #Статьи
Please open Telegram to view this post
VIEW IN TELEGRAM
👍95🔥2😁2
🖥 Как работает память компьютера?

Из этого видео вы узнаете, как работает память компьютера — один из основных аспектов программирования, понимание которого должно быть у каждого разработчика.

👉 Изучив данную тему, вы сможете лучше разобраться в том, что вообще происходит в вашем редакторе кода и зачем вы это делаете.


Ссылка: Клик!

Easy WebDev | #Видео
Please open Telegram to view this post
VIEW IN TELEGRAM
5🔥4👍3
🧑‍💻 24 проверенных способа оптимизации фронтенда

Производительность фронтенда напрямую влияет на впечатление от вашего проекта.

👉 Даже самый крутой дизайн и интересный контент не удержат пользователя, если страница тормозит или беспощадно грузит браузер.

В этом материале разбираем проверенные подходы, которые помогут приложению летать на любых устройствах.


Ссылка: Клик!

Easy WebDev | #Статьи
Please open Telegram to view this post
VIEW IN TELEGRAM
👍4🔥4
500+ тестов по разным направлениям разработки

Quizzes.madza.dev — платформа, на которой можно пройти тесты по различным темам разработки.

Кратко про ресурс:
🔵Есть сохранение прогресса и подсказки;
🔵Выдача правильного варианта после ответа;
🔵500+ вопросов по 20 категориям;
🔵Есть возможность добавления вопросов.

Как по мне, отличный способ провести время и узнать новое проблемно-ориентированным способом 👍


Ссылка: Клик!

Easy WebDev | #Ресурсы
Please open Telegram to view this post
VIEW IN TELEGRAM
👍6🔥32
🌐 Расширение для браузера за 10 минут своими руками

Из этой статьи вы узнаете, как сделать расширение для браузера, способное запускать любой скрипт на любой странице.

👉 Охватим принцип, на основе которого можно делать собственные расширения, в том числе намного более сложные.


Ссылка: Клик!

Easy WebDev | #Статьи
Please open Telegram to view this post
VIEW IN TELEGRAM
👍5🔥5
📚 Большая коллекция бесплатных книг и других материалов для программистов

В этом репозитории лежит огромная коллекция бесплатного контента — книги, курсы, шпаргалки и другие материалы для проггеров всех направлений.

👉 Есть удобная навигация по видам материалов и направлениям. Каждый найдёт что-то для себя.


Ссылка: Клик!

Easy WebDev | #Ресурсы
Please open Telegram to view this post
VIEW IN TELEGRAM
🔥53👍3
🖥 Автоматический HTTPS для ленивых: ACME + Angie один раз и навсегда

ACME — протокол, который позволяет получать и обновлять сертификаты без ручного вмешательства. Он делает HTTPS более доступным и безопасным.

👉 В данной статье описываются преимущества использования ACME: безопасность, удобство, масштабируемость и экономия времени.

Также рассматривается процесс настройки функции с использованием Angie, CGI-хука, OctoDNS и локального CGI-сервера.


Ссылка: Клик!

Easy WebDev | #Статьи
Please open Telegram to view this post
VIEW IN TELEGRAM
🔥4👍322😱1
😳 Frontend и Backend всё? Рынок перегрет, ИИ заменил айтишников

Думаю, из названия ролика уже понятно, что в нём лежит ответка на главные тезисы ИИ-истерии последних лет.

По факту, видео содержит:
🔵Адекватные причины трудностей в поиске работы;
🔵Реальные рекомендации по повышению своей позиции на рынке труда.


Ссылка: Клик!

Easy WebDev | #Видео
Please open Telegram to view this post
VIEW IN TELEGRAM
👍63🔥2😁2
Эффективная многопоточность в Node.js: как использовать Atomics

Представь, что несколько человек пытаются писать в одном блокноте одновременно — получится каша.

👉 То же самое происходит, когда несколько потоков в программе пытаются работать с одними данными.

В этой статье разберёмся, как Atomics помогает держать всё под контролем.


Ссылка: Клик!

Easy WebDev | #Статьи
Please open Telegram to view this post
VIEW IN TELEGRAM
👍4🔥4
🧑‍💻 Бесплатный курс-тренажёр по C#

Нашёл для вас практический курс по C#, в котором лежит множество разнообразных задач и упражнений для кодеров.

👉 В ходе обучения вы встретите как с классические, так и продвинутые задания, которые часто встречаются на собеседованиях в ведущих компаниях.


Ссылка: Клик!

Easy WebDev | #Курсы
Please open Telegram to view this post
VIEW IN TELEGRAM
4👍4🔥3
🐱 16 универсальных идей для пет-проектов вне зависимости от языка

Хотите создать что-нибудь крутое в качестве пет-проекта, но не хватает вдохновения и насмотренности?

👉 Держите 16 универсальных идей для пополнения портфолио.

Каждая из идей не имеет привязанности к ЯП, что делает их гибкими в реализации.


Ссылка: Клик!

Easy WebDev | #Статьи
Please open Telegram to view this post
VIEW IN TELEGRAM
6👍4🔥3
📕 Большая коллекция полезных материалов для Backend-разработчиков

Наткнулся на крутую подборку ресурсов и гайдов для изучения Backend-разработки, которая поможет систематизировать знания и составить план обучения.

👉 Готовый список основан на личном опыте автора после самостоятельного изучения данной области.


Ссылка: Клик!

Easy WebDev | #Ресурсы
Please open Telegram to view this post
VIEW IN TELEGRAM
👍3🔥2🙏211💯1
🌳 Основные команды Git для повседневных задач

Автор этой статьи рассказал: как работает Git, какие основные команды нужно знать, как пользоваться, и как они помогают решать повседневные задачи.

👉 Даже если ты только начинаешь свой путь в разработке — не бойся, здесь всё будет объяснено просто, без сложных терминов и с примерами из жизни.


Ссылка: Клик!

Easy WebDev | #Статьи
Please open Telegram to view this post
VIEW IN TELEGRAM
4👍4🔥3🤩1
🖥 Создаём Frontend приложение с нуля: 3 часа практики

В данном видео автор предлагает пошаговый гайд по созданию собственного трекера прогресса в обучении, написанного с помощью HTML, CSS и ванильного JS.

Как по мне, неплохая практика для новичков, плюсик в портфолио, да и к тому же — может быть реально применим для фиксирования личного прогресса 👍


Ссылка: Клик!

Easy WebDev | #Видео
Please open Telegram to view this post
VIEW IN TELEGRAM
👍64🔥32👨‍💻1
🖥 Учимся безболезненно переносить и клонировать серверы

Даже если вы не планируете в ближайшее время клонировать сервер или мигрировать на другую инфраструктуру, лучше разобраться в этом вопросе заранее.

👉 В данной статье рассказали, как перенести сервер с помощью снапшота и прямой передачи данных по сети — без создания образов и остановки сервисов.


Ссылка: Клик!

Easy WebDev | #Статьи
Please open Telegram to view this post
VIEW IN TELEGRAM
👍7🔥3💯3